Biography
Dawn Swink is passionate about teaching business law and truly enjoys getting to know the students at St. Thomas. She believes every student should study abroad at least once during their college career so she has become involved in this, as well. She co-directed the London Business Semester in 2005 and 2014; and co-directed a UMAIE BLAW J-term course in Australia in 2010. Dawn has three main research interests: employment law, e-commerce, and reproductive law. She has published numerous articles in scholarly journals including the American Business Law Journal, Brigham Young University Law Review, and the University of Maryland Law School's Journal of Health Care Law & Policy. She has won several awards for her articles. Swink is currently the Editor-in-Chief of the Midwest Law Journal and serves as an articles reviewer for the Journal for Legal Studies in Education.
